Title: Veli-Pekka Junttila: Innovator in Smart Technology
Introduction
Veli-Pekka Junttila, based in Oulu, Finland, is a notable inventor with a focus on innovative technologies in the electronics sector. With five patents to his name, Junttila has made significant contributions to the field of electronic device communication and control.
Latest Patents
Junttila's latest patents demonstrate his expertise in enhancing the functionality and efficiency of electronic devices. One such innovation is a method of controlling an electronic device that incorporates a removable smart card. This method enables the device to request context data from the smart card, which then responds by sending the relevant data back to the device. Additionally, the smart card's power is managed effectively, allowing for a reduction and restoration of power as necessary while ensuring data integrity.
Another recent patent involves a method of communication between an electronic device and a cellular network. This patented technology outlines a communication protocol that allows devices to initiate a connection with a network by issuing information criteria. Once the connection is established, the network is capable of forwarding only the necessary communications, thereby optimizing the data flow according to the device's requirements.
Career Highlights
Throughout his career, Junttila has worked with prominent companies such as Nordic Semiconductor ASA and Nokia Corporation. His roles in these organizations have allowed him to hone his skills and contribute to significant advancements in technology.
